Notes | Lead phosphite dibasic is an Avail. commercially as the hemihydrate Lead phosphite dibasic uses and applications include: Heat and light (UV screening and antioxidizing) stabilizer for vinyl plastics and chlorinated paraffins; UV stabilizer and antioxidant in paints; white rust-inhibitive pigment in paints and plastics; acid acceptor in rubber processing Suggested storage of Lead phosphite dibasic: Store in closed containers below 400 F, away from open flame or sparks |
